They're UK headquartered. New York executes most of the deals whereas the LA and Canadian offices usually provide a lot of the support for the deals that the New York office runs.

 

NY office is a fair office. Sharper professionals, friendly yet hard working culture, comp is lower that the streets. Base should be about similar, maybe less at analyst and associate levels but bonus is certainly lower from my understanding.

Has anyone had more experience with this firm? Particularly their LA office? Would love some insight on the types of deals, complexity of deals, and comp if so. thanks.

 

@00boom00 la office works on companies with revenues anywhere from as low as $1M to $50M (you'd be lucky if you found yourself working on a company with above $20M in rev). BCMS is simply a business broker, focused on selling companies. Not your stereotypical "investment bank" and I don't mean that in a good way.
